I just got this 2001 Ford Taurus SES, very nice looking car. This car only had one owner ( I run a Carfax report) The LCD for the radio is out but the radio still works, I already checked the dim ligth switch and it is OK.
The lights inside of the car will stay on sometimes for about 1 minite or so. This happens when I start the car, it doesn't matter if the car is in P or D or R. The front panel shows a door being open. I alrady check the doors and the trunk too. This morning I tried the Cruise Control for the first time and it worked but I couldn't shut it off with the OFF buttom. It only went off when I press on the brake pedal. I will apreciate any comments please. Carlos M. |

The door ajar light and the dome light staying on are probably due to stuck door latches. Use WD-40 or some other decent lubricant on all 4 door latches and work them a few times.
My best guess on the cruise control is a bad switch, but others may have suggestions. |

They're in the doors. Trust me, you'll see it when you go look. You'll see the hook on the door that they latch on to. You just have to lubricate the swinging latch on the door that moves.
Try opening and closing your door very slowly and watch what happens and lubricate the moving parts. Then work the latch with your hands or open and close the door a few times. |
